    Overview
    This document attempts to explain in the brief the credit card processing in SAP.
    SAP provides a flexible and secure payment card interface that works with the
    software of selected partners that provide merchant processes and clearing house
    services. In SAP the credit card processing is integrated with the sales and
    distribution module.
    Payment card configuration
    Much of what is required for credit card processing to work with VISA, Master
    Card, and American Express is already set up in SAP.
    For all credit card configurations refer to
    Define Card Types
    Transaction SPRO IMG ‡ Sales and Distribution ‡ Billing ‡ Payment Cards
    Here we define the type of cards that can be used in the system. A four-letter
    code is given for each card type. E.g. MAST for Master Card, VSAJ for Visa
    Japan. A function module for checking the card number is also specified here.

    Maintain Card Categories
    (a) Define card Categories: Here we specify the card category of the
    payment card. With this the system automatically determines the card
    category when you enter a card number in master data or sales
    documents.
    (b) Determine card categories: Here we specify the acceptable number
    ranges for different card types. Also card categories are assigned to the
    card types. Even though SAP comes with card checking algorithms
    (Function Modules) for standard card types this configuration setting
    is particularly useful to those cards that do not contain any standard
    checking algorithm already set up in SAP.

    Maintain Payment Card Plan Type
    In this step, you assign the payment plan type for payment cards, the payment
    card plan type, to all sales document types in which you will be using payment
    cards. You cannot process payment cards if you have not made this assignment
    The standard system contains payment plan type 03 for processing payment
    cards. 3. Show the screen where this assignment is done.
    Credit Card Configuration And Processing In SAP
    3. Maintain Payment Plan Type
    Maintain Blocking Reasons
    In this step, you define blocking reasons for payment cards. You enter these in
    the payer master record to block cards. The standard system contains blocking
    reason 01 for lost cards.

    Maintain Checking Groups
    How and when authorizations are carried out depends on the setting you make in
    the customizing for maintain checking group routines.
    The three main settings that influence authorization are:
    a) Authorization requirements
    b) Authorization horizon
    c) Preauthorization
    There are two settings under this setting.
    Define checking group: Here a checking group is defined and the
    authorization requirement (described in the previous section), Authorization
    horizon (described below) and preauthorization settings are done for this
    checking group.
    5. Define Checking Group
    Credit Card Configuration And Processing In SAP
    Here you can see a checking group C1 is defined with the authorization
    requirement 902. Checking the pre-authorization tells the system to carryout preauthorization
    if the order fulfillment date falls outside the horizon. The
    authorization horizon specifies the number of days before the material
    availability date, or billing date, that the system is to initiate authorization. If a
    sales order is saved within the authorization horizon, the system carries out
    authorization immediately. If a sales order is saved before the authorization
    horizon comes into effect, the system does not authorize at all, or carries out
    preauthorization.
    6. Preauthorization Concept
    In this example, the system has been set to authorize one day before delivery
    creation. The system does not carry out authorization when the order is saved on
    Day 0, rather on Day 2. Note that the authorization validity period has been set to
    14 days in Customizing IMG‡ Authorization and settlement‡ Specify
    authorization validity periods. The transaction will have to be reauthorized if
    delivery activities take longer than 14 days.

    Account Determination
    Transaction SPRO IMG ‡ Sales and Distribution ‡ Billing ‡ Payment Cards‡
    Authorization and settlement ‡ Maintain Clearing House
    In the following steps, you set the condition technique for determining
    clearinghouse reconciliation accounts for authorization and settlement. The
    system uses the entries here to determine the clearing account for the payment
    card charges. When settlement is run, the postings in the receivable account for
    the payment card will be credited and a consolidated debit will be created and
    posted to the clearinghouse account. These accounts are a special type of general
    ledger account that is posted from Sales and Distribution.
    Here, you maintain:
    • Maintain field catalog.
    • Condition tables and the fields that they contain
    • Access sequences and condition types
    • Account determination procedures
    • You then assign these accounts to condition types.

    Authorization and Settlement in SAP
    20. Sales Order Cycle With Credit Card Authorization
    When an order is placed through the front-end system, the order information,
    credit card information, billing information, shipping information is passed to
    SAP. SAP processes the order calculates the taxes, the shipping costs and reads
    the configuration information settings and executes the function module setup as
    described in Fig. 18. The function module formats the data and makes a RFC *
    call to the payment application**.
    The payment application screens the order for fraud, encrypts the data and
    communicates with the third party processor who in turns communicates with
    the card association and card issuer.
    *RFC (Remote Function Call)
    *Payment Application: Middle ware between SAP and third party processor/bank.
    Credit Card Configuration And Processing In SAP
    The third party processor responds back with the response whether the
    transaction is approved or declined or referred.
    Note: When any item in the order does not have a confirmed quantity, then
    authorization is not carried out for the full amount. A small dollar amount
    usually ($1) is used as the authorization amount. During the rescheduling run
    the system will check for the material availability. If the material can be
    delivered within the horizon date, a full authorization for the order is carried
    out.
    Approved: When the credit card transaction is approved the systems checks for
    the material availability, confirms the material for the ordered quantity and saves
    the order.
    Declined: The material availability check for the material is not made, and the
    order is rejected.
    Referred: The order is saved and is blocked for delivery. In this situation is
    merchant calls the bank checks for the available credit on the card and a manual
    authorization is carried out.

    Settlement
    Legally the merchant can charge the credit card after the order has been
    completely processed. In SAP this happens after a delivery is created and the
    goods has been shipped. In case there is not enough authorization for the order
    to be delivered, the system goes out the get the authorization for the remaining
    amount.
    In SAP settlement is initiated using the transaction FCC1. All the valid
    authorization is submitted in a batch to the payment application at scheduled
    intervals as specified by the third party processor.
    The payment application encrypts this data and communicates with the third
    party processor. The third party processor checks if the settlement request has a
    valid authorization against it. The third party processor then transfers the fund
    from the cardholder’s bank to the merchant bank.
